Definition

Expense of raising contributed support in the period — development staff, donor communications, event production labour, grant writing and prospect research. The third FASB functional class. Direct benefit costs of a special event are NOT here; they net against the event revenue line.

Formula

Expenses allocated to fundraising activity for the period, excluding the direct benefit costs netted against special-event revenue.

Why it matters

The investment side of the contributed-revenue equation — read on its own it looks like overhead, read against what it raised it is a return.

How to interpret

Pair with finance.np_cost_to_raise_a_dollar; cutting fundraising expense reliably improves the programme ratio and reliably shrinks the organisation.
